Understanding the Basics
A driving license is a main file that certifies an individual's ability to operate a motor lorry. It is provided by a federal government agency and is required to legally drive in most countries. The process of acquiring a driving license can differ depending on the jurisdiction, however it typically involves numerous crucial steps.
Actions to Obtain a Driving License
Determine Eligibility
Age Requirements: Most nations have a minimum age requirement for acquiring a driver's license. In the United States, for instance, the minimum age is typically 16 years of ages, however this can differ by state.Residency: You must be a legal homeowner of the state or nation where you are requesting a license.Medical Fitness: You must meet certain health and vision requirements to ensure you can securely operate a vehicle.
Research Study the Driving Manual
Driving Manual: Each state or country supplies a driving handbook that covers traffic laws, roadway indications, and safe driving practices. It is necessary to thoroughly study this handbook to get ready for the written test.Online Resources: Many jurisdictions use online resources, such as practice tests and interactive tutorials, to help you prepare.
Take the Written Test
Test Format: The composed test generally includes multiple-choice concerns that assess your understanding of traffic laws and safe driving practices.Passing Score: The passing rating varies by jurisdiction, but it is generally around 80%.Retakes: If you do not pass the test on your first attempt, you can normally retake it after a certain period.
Total Driver's Education (if required)
Driver's Education: Some states or nations need brand-new drivers to finish a motorist's education course. This can be carried out in a class setting or online.Behind-the-Wheel Training: In addition to classroom instruction, you may need to finish a particular number of hours of behind-the-wheel training with a certified instructor.
Obtain a Learner's Permit
Application Process: You can apply for a student's license at your local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or comparable company.Files Required: You will need to offer proof of identity, residency, and age. Appropriate documents normally consist of a birth certificate, passport, and energy bill.Costs: There is normally a fee for the student's permit, which can differ by jurisdiction.
Practice Driving
Supervised Driving: With a learner's authorization, you can practice driving under the guidance of a licensed grownup. This is an important action to get confidence and experience.Practice Tips: Start in low-traffic locations and slowly work your way as much as more tough driving conditions. Take the Driving Test
Test Format: The driving test examines your capability to safely operate a car. You will be assessed on your driving abilities, adherence to traffic laws, and general security.Test Day: On the day of your test, arrive early, bring your learner's license, and ensure your automobile remains in good condition.Passing Criteria: The passing criteria can differ, however generally, you need to show safe and proficient driving abilities.
Receive Your Driver's License
License Types: Depending on your age and experience, you might get a provisionary or full motorist's license. Provisional licenses often come with restrictions, such as a curfew or guest limitations.License Renewal: Your license will have an expiration date. Q: Can I drive with a learner's authorization?A: Yes, however you should be accompanied by a certified grownup who is at least 21 years of ages (the age requirement might vary by jurisdiction). You are also based on certain limitations, such as a curfew or traveler limitations.

Q: What takes place if I stop working the driving test?A: If you stop working the driving test, you can usually retake it after a certain period. The waiting duration and number of retakes enabled can differ by jurisdiction. Utilize the time to practice and enhance your driving skills.

Q: Can I transfer my driver's license to a brand-new state?A: Yes, many states allow you to move your chauffeur's license if you move. You will need to check out the local DMV and provide proof of your brand-new address. You may also need to take a vision test or a written test, depending on the state.

Q: What should I do if my motorist's license is lost or taken?A: If your chauffeur's license is lost or stolen, report it to the DMV immediately. You will need to look for a replacement license, which might involve a cost. Be sure to also report the loss to your local authorities department.
